How can individuals effectively incorporate constructive criticism into their personal and professional growth strategies to maximize their potential?

Feedback
Individuals can effectively incorporate constructive criticism into their personal and professional growth strategies by first being open-minded and willing to receive feedback. They should actively seek out feedback from trusted mentors, peers, and supervisors to gain different perspectives on their performance. It is important to reflect on the feedback received and identify areas for improvement, setting specific goals and action plans to address them. Finally, individuals should consistently apply the feedback they receive, making adjustments to their behavior or work habits to maximize their potential for growth and development.
